About American Psychological Association H-1B Visa Data
This page provides detailed H-1B visa salary information for positions at American Psychological Association. The data presented here comes from Labor Condition Applications (LCAs) filed with the U.S. Department of Labor. With 10 positions recorded, this information offers valuable insight into American Psychological Association's compensation practices for specialty occupation workers.
Understanding Salary Data
The prevailing wage shown represents the minimum wage employers must pay H-1B workers based on the job's skill level and location. The average salary of $102,648reflects the typical compensation package at American Psychological Association for H-1B specialty occupation roles.
